Re: Alpha 1 stern drive thump

Yep, they turn whenever the engine is running, only in neutral, they don't have any signifigant load on them. Also when the drive is down and centered they have less load on them than when the drive is turned to full port or starboard..Thats why they ususally rattle more when the drive is turned...
